What is Diploma in Warehousing and Inventory Management?
Warehouses and inventories are the major part of any retail business. They need to be managed very effectively and efficiently at all times. The mismanagement of these inventories can lead to great losses and chaos. This is why inventory systems have also come up and these need to be learned and known well. The diploma in warehousing and inventory management teaches these applications, systems, tools, processes, functions, methods, etc so that these industries and services can be managed in time to get profits. The subjects include inventory control, record keeping, traffic management, purchasing, computerized logistics, supervision and leadership, and many others, etc.

Scope of Diploma in Warehousing and Inventory Management
A Diploma in Warehousing and Inventory Management from a great institute is really beneficial to students. In the era of fast-paced e-commerce, big warehouses and goods are the backbones of these websites. To manage the inventory of products, inventory experts are in high demand.
Students can pursue a career in Industrial Inventory Management, Inventory Controller, Asset Inventory Management, Warehouse Supervisor & Inventory Manager.
